Transcribed from: Lover, Samuel, 1797-1868. The Greek boy : a musical drama, in two acts. As performed at the Theatre Royal, Covent-Garden. Correctly printed from the prompter's copy, with the cast of characters, costume, scenic arrangement, sides of entrance and exit, and relative position of the dramatis personae. Splendidly illustrated with an etching, by Pierce Egan, the younger, from a drawing taken during the representation of the piece London : Sherwood, Gilbert, and Piper, 1840. 33 p.
